Bion Environmental Technologies (OTCMKTS:BNET – Get Free Report) released its quarterly earnings results on Friday. The basic materials company reported ($0.01) EPS for the quarter, Zacks reports.
Bion Environmental Technologies Price Performance
Bion Environmental Technologies stock opened at $0.24 on Friday. Bion Environmental Technologies has a 52-week low of $0.08 and a 52-week high of $0.38. The firm has a market capitalization of $13.89 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-7.97 and a beta of 0.87. The firm has a 50-day moving average price of $0.25 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$0.22.
Bion Environmental Technologies Company Profile
Bion Environmental Technologies, Inc is a U.S.‐based environmental technology company that develops and licenses proprietary systems to convert solid waste into energy and reusable materials. The company’s core offering revolves around its patented Bion-Structured Catalyst (BSC), a specialized catalytic process designed to break down a diverse range of feedstocks, including municipal solid waste, plastics, tires, rubber, and biomass. By integrating this technology into modular processing platforms, Bion provides a turnkey solution for organizations seeking to reduce landfill dependency and recover value from waste streams.
Utilizing an advanced thermochemical conversion process, Bion’s BSC technology transforms waste into clean synthesis gas (syngas), bio-oil and char.
